Mr. Gerry M. Phillips, age 77, of Vidalia, died Sunday, February 1, 2026, at Memorial Health Meadows Hospital in Vidalia following an extended illness. He was a native of Toombs County and lived in Vidalia most of his life. Earlier in Gerry’s life, he worked with Piggly Wiggly and Sunbeam. He was also a member of a carpenter’s union, and in 1985, he purchased Kerrigan’s in Lyons. Other than working hard all of his life, his top priority was taking care of his wife and family.
He is preceded in death by his parents, Buford Phillips and Eudell Stewart Phillips; one brother, Kenneth Phillips; and one sister, Sara Phillips.
Mr. Phillips is survived by his wife of twenty-one years, Lisa Loyd Phillips; one daughter, Lacie Wilkes Phillips; grandson, Brentley Sexton; honorary daughter, Brittney Sexton, all of Vidalia; two brothers, Perry Phillips and wife Ginger of Dahlonega, and Larry Phillips and wife Cynthia of Atlanta; one sister, Diane Phillips and wife Tina of North Carolina; numerous nieces and nephews, and many close friends who looked at Gerry as their mentor, including, Jason Beckworth, Justin Skipper, Joe Bush, “Tank” Thompson, Tony Nobles, Danny Flowers, Charlie Clark, Jay Harbin, Shane NeeSmith, Dwayne Hall, Odis Clark, William Kilgore, Doug Clark, Wayne Youmans, Duncan Parkerson, Johnny Jackson, Billy Tidwell, Bobby Arnold, and R.J. Arnold.
